Mary E. Sisco, age 87, of Wayne passed Sunday, August 21, 2022.
She was born in Paterson to James and Theresa Harrington. She was part of the first graduating class from Wayne High School graduating with the Class of 1953 and has lived in Wayne for the past over 60 years.
Just out of high school Mary worked at the NJ Bell Telephone Company in Pompton Lakes as a switchboard operator. She later worked as an Administrative Assistant for the Metal Craft Company in Wayne and at the General Electric Companies Customer Service in Wayne. In her later years she worked as an Administrative Assistant for Seton Hall University in South Orange before retiring on her 75th birthday - June 1, 2010.
In her youth Mary was a Bobby Soxer and loved to dance with her girlfriends. For Christmas, Saint Patrick’s Day, and her birthday she went all out decorating. She also made the best Irish Soda Bread – a skill she learned from her mom. Most of all Mary was a dedicated, loving, and devoted mother and grandmother.
Mary's friendship was a treasure easily shared with anyone in need. Her friendships were life long and cherished. She was a caring sister who watched over her little brothers and helped to keep them safe and secure. Mary raised her sons with love and understanding. She created a home for them where all their friends were welcomed and respected.
Mary was dedicated to her Catholic Faith and was a devout parishioner of Holy Cross Church in Wayne and more recently Our Lady of Consolation Church also in Wayne.
She was the loving mother of William T. Sisco of Wayne and Brian Sisco and his wife Jill of Smyrna, GA; cherished grandmother of Anndrea and Tiffany Sisco; and she was the dearly loved sister of Kevin P. Harrington, ESQ and his loving companion Colleen of Wayne and John J. Harrington of Suwanee, GA. She was preceded in death by her brothers James J. Harrington and Thomas E. Harrington.
